Our leading investment banking client is looking for an Executive Assistant on a 6 month contract, inside IR35, with a view to extend further. Please note this is a floating role which will require you to work with a number of executives inside the bank.

Key Responsibilities

  • Diary management to allocated Executive Managers: Act as gate keeper, maintain, organise and plan ahead to ensure the smooth running of day to day.
  • Pay attention to any changes or amendment of schedule and make sure your Executive is informed in a timely manner.
  • Leverage your knowledge/experiences to take initiative in better organising the diary and plan/think ahead in advance to avoid delay/issues.
  • Be ready to question meetings to organise and raise alternative ideas proactively when appropriate.
  • Coordinating with other Exec assistants internal and external, to understand management whereabouts and to provide seamless cover at all times.
  • Arranging weekly management meetings: collecting slides, prepare agenda using PowerPoint/PDF and distribute them via email/SharePoint.
  • Screening and prioritising phone calls and emails.
  • Coordination of conference calls (internal and external) and appropriate meeting room bookings in accordance with internal systems based on requirements.
  • Booking business trips including the organisation of transport, travel itineraries and visa requirements by following the bank policies and procedure.
  • Organising internal Townhalls, off and on-site seminars, gathering for your Executive managers.
  • Ensuring all expenses have been processed following the Group and Global Markets procedure and policies.
  • Anticipate needs and proactively addressing them.
  • Building and maintaining professional relationships.
  • Demonstrating strong organisational and multitasking skills.
  • Providing seamless support while working from home.
  • Being responsive and available.
  • General Services management including but not limited to photocopying, filing and archiving, scanning, ordering magazines, stationery, payment of invoices, arranging couriers, business cards, managing DL, approving requests on behalf of your Executives by following the bank policies and procedure etc.
  • Other ad-hoc tasks requested by Executive Managers.

How to prepare for a job interview at Impellam Group

Know Your Diary Management

Since the role heavily involves diary management, brush up on your skills in this area. Be prepared to discuss how you’ve successfully managed complex schedules in the past and share specific examples of how you’ve handled last-minute changes or conflicts.

Showcase Your Proactivity

Executives appreciate an assistant who can think ahead. During the interview, highlight instances where you took the initiative to improve processes or anticipate needs. This could be anything from streamlining meeting agendas to suggesting better ways to organise travel itineraries.

Demonstrate Strong Communication Skills

Effective communication is key in this role. Be ready to explain how you’ve built and maintained professional relationships in previous positions. You might even want to prepare a brief example of a time when your communication skills helped resolve a misunderstanding or improved team collaboration.

Familiarise Yourself with Financial Services

Having experience in financial services is crucial for this position. Make sure you understand the basics of compliance and regulatory requirements. It’s a good idea to research the company’s values and recent news to show that you’re genuinely interested and informed about the industry.
